Commit Graph

577 Commits

Author SHA1 Message Date
35ef3e5a6e Fix KDE_APPLNK_DIR to not install to a diff prefix, and disable installing
2003-04-21  Rodney Dawes  <dobey@ximian.com>

	* configure.in: Fix KDE_APPLNK_DIR to not install to a diff prefix,
	and disable installing the file to the KDE applnk path by default

svn path=/trunk/; revision=20915
2003-04-22 14:54:15 +00:00
e07d3adc4f 1.3.2.99.
svn path=/trunk/; revision=20827
2003-04-11 19:48:20 +00:00
b1a244dcb1 Sync for 1.3.2.
svn path=/trunk/; revision=20794
2003-04-09 20:37:56 +00:00
3b5fc9292b Oops, don't use a == when comparing strings in shell.
2003-04-07  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Oops, don't use a == when comparing strings in
	shell.

svn path=/trunk/; revision=20724
2003-04-07 19:12:46 +00:00
f2fca1f315 add addressbook/tools/Makefile to AC_OUTPUT.
2003-04-07  Chris Toshok  <toshok@ximian.com>

	* configure.in: add addressbook/tools/Makefile to AC_OUTPUT.

svn path=/trunk/; revision=20710
2003-04-07 16:22:50 +00:00
325edf034c Ported check for "killall" vs. "killp" back from
1.2.

svn path=/trunk/; revision=20571
2003-03-28 23:39:25 +00:00
54be14a8e6 Autogen help/Makefile.
* configure.in: Autogen help/Makefile.

* Makefile.am (SUBDIRS): Add help.  [#38234]

svn path=/trunk/; revision=20528
2003-03-26 23:02:26 +00:00
b6b70c0bf9 Fixed Heimdal include path.
2003-03-25  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Fixed Heimdal include path.

svn path=/trunk/; revision=20507
2003-03-25 18:23:46 +00:00
9643a66cfc Fix the mit krb5+krb4 check to work with --without-kr5
2003-03-21  Rodney Dawes  <dobey@ximian.com>

	* configure.in: Fix the mit krb5+krb4 check to work with --without-kr5

svn path=/trunk/; revision=20464
2003-03-22 06:00:44 +00:00
70c39223a7 Fixed a type-o in the krb5 checks.
2003-03-18  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Fixed a type-o in the krb5 checks.

svn path=/trunk/; revision=20354
2003-03-19 03:20:22 +00:00
3c45028a08 Add gthread-2.0, to get any thread-specific flags (like -D_REENTRANT).
2003-03-19  Not Zed  <NotZed@Ximian.com>

        * configure.in (CAMEL_*, E_UTIL_*, ): Add gthread-2.0, to get any
        thread-specific flags (like -D_REENTRANT).  Duh.  For #39886.
        (LIBIBEX*): Removed old libibex stuff.

svn path=/trunk/; revision=20353
2003-03-19 02:48:16 +00:00
2585b48f24 Added AC_C_INLINE - this should fix bug #39171.
2003-03-06  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Added AC_C_INLINE - this should fix bug #39171.

svn path=/trunk/; revision=20190
2003-03-06 14:58:23 +00:00
64c201dff2 Fix kerberos include paths.
2003-03-05  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Fix kerberos include paths.

svn path=/trunk/; revision=20184
2003-03-06 00:02:33 +00:00
53e2f660cd Up to 1.3.1.99.
svn path=/trunk/; revision=20182
2003-03-05 22:14:35 +00:00
5569968699 Add calendar/importers/Makefile to output.
2003-02-28  Hans Petter Jansson  <hpj@ximian.com>

	* configure.in: Add calendar/importers/Makefile to output.

	* calendar/Makefile.am (SUBDIRS): Add importers/.

	* calendar/importers/Makefile.am (server_in_files)
	(server_DATA): Insert $(libexecdir).

	* calendar/importers/icalendar-importer.c (connect_to_shell):
	oaf_activate_from_id() -> bonobo_activation_activate_from_id().
	(load_vcalendar_file): U_() -> _().

svn path=/trunk/; revision=20109
2003-02-28 21:08:45 +00:00
c1c1b6e199 export gnome-pilot cflags
2003-02-27  JP Rosevear  <jpr@ximian.com>

	* configure.in: export gnome-pilot cflags

svn path=/trunk/; revision=20090
2003-02-27 23:04:35 +00:00
337092268a fixed
svn path=/trunk/; revision=19967
2003-02-20 05:22:35 +00:00
420926a837 AC_DEFINE() ENABLE_IPv6 if it should be enabled.
2003-02-19  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in (ENABLE_IPv6): AC_DEFINE() ENABLE_IPv6 if it should
	be enabled.

svn path=/trunk/; revision=19953
2003-02-19 23:42:46 +00:00
fe77d02dd0 Add fr to ALL_LINGUAS again.
svn path=/trunk/; revision=19838
2003-02-06 23:26:44 +00:00
11136022cc Fix KRB4_CFLAGS to work correctly Fix desktop file installation path Use
2003-02-06  Rodney Dawes  <dobey@ximian.com>

	* configure.in: Fix KRB4_CFLAGS to work correctly
	* data/Makefile.am: Fix desktop file installation path
	* data/evolution.desktop.in: Use correct binary and categories, add
	StartupNotify=1 also, for startup-notification-enabled systems

svn path=/trunk/; revision=19832
2003-02-06 23:20:45 +00:00
db141482ef export priv*dir for libical's configure to use.
* configure.in: export priv*dir for libical's configure to use.

svn path=/trunk/; revision=19822
2003-02-06 18:13:12 +00:00
2b798e6820 Define and AC_SUBST privlibexecdir, privdatadir, privincludedir,
* configure.in: Define and AC_SUBST privlibexecdir, privdatadir,
	privincludedir, serverdir, evolutionuidir, imagesdir, buttonsdir,
	soundsdir, gladedir, etspecdir, and viewsdir.

svn path=/trunk/; revision=19769
2003-02-05 21:46:03 +00:00
e703f44dbb define and AC_SUBST privlibexecdir.
* configure.in: define and AC_SUBST privlibexecdir.

	* evolution-shell.pc.in: Add privlibexecdir, componentdir,
	evolutionuidir, and iconsdir.

svn path=/trunk/; revision=19758
2003-02-05 17:23:09 +00:00
75402d39ad Update AC_DEFINEs to use the new syntax to make acconfig.h unnecessary.
* configure.in: Update AC_DEFINEs to use the new syntax to make
	acconfig.h unnecessary. (Remove unneeded HAVE_KDE_APPLNK define).
	Call GNOME_COMPILE_WARNINGS and add $WARN_CFLAGS to CFLAGS to get
	back to the evo 1.2 behavior of defaulting to -Wall everywhere.
	Fix up privlibdir definition to avoid undefined variables in
	evolution-shell.pc.

	* acinclude.m4: Update AC_DEFINE

	* acconfig.h: Gone

svn path=/trunk/; revision=19742
2003-02-04 20:57:25 +00:00
5839d83bd2 add gnome-vfs-module-2.0 to the deps so we pick up the right include path.
2003-02-03  Chris Toshok  <toshok@ximian.com>

	* configure.in (EVOLUTION_MAIL): add gnome-vfs-module-2.0 to the
	deps so we pick up the right include path.

svn path=/trunk/; revision=19724
2003-02-04 07:57:30 +00:00
1b564cc2a2 remove the --enable-shlib-components stuff.
2003-02-03  Chris Toshok  <toshok@ximian.com>

	* configure.in: remove the --enable-shlib-components stuff.

svn path=/trunk/; revision=19723
2003-02-04 01:26:22 +00:00
45f610c510 conditionally define which krb5 impl we have
svn path=/trunk/; revision=19677
2003-01-29 00:31:48 +00:00
9fec09fdf7 Updated to add gssapi libs, since this is what we use krb5 for :-)
2003-01-28  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in (HAVE_KRB5): Updated to add gssapi libs, since this
	is what we use krb5 for :-)

svn path=/trunk/; revision=19675
2003-01-28 23:56:59 +00:00
1d9a3023e5 #include bonobo-activation instead of oaf. (main): Initialize using
* tools/evolution-addressbook-export.c: #include bonobo-activation
instead of oaf.
(main): Initialize using gnome_program_init().
(save_cards): Use g_main_loop_quit() instead of gtk_exit().

* tools/evolution-addressbook-import.c: Update include list for
GNOME 2.
(main): Initialize using gnome_program_init().
(unref_executable): Use g_main_loop_quit() instead of gtk_exit().
(add_cb): Likewise.

* tools/evolution-addressbook-abuse.c: Update include list for
GNOME 2.
(main): Initialize using gnome_program_init().
(use_addressbook): Use g_object_unref() instead of
gtk_object_unref().
(main): Use g_timeout_add() instead of gtk_timeout_add().
(add_cb): Use g_main_loop_quit() instead of gtk_exit().

* configure.in (AC_SUBST): Add tools/Makefile.

* Makefile.am (SUBDIRS): Add tools/ back into the list.

* tools/Makefile.am: Install everything in
$(datadir)/evolution-$(BASE_VERSION)/tools.
(INCLUDES): Add the defines that gnome_program_init() likes and
also add the _DISABLE_DEPRECATED stuff.

svn path=/trunk/; revision=19656
2003-01-27 18:54:56 +00:00
58f0adcb24 add in the conduit Makefile's.
2003-01-26  Chris Toshok  <toshok@ximian.com>

	* configure.in (AC_OUTPUT): add in the conduit Makefile's.

svn path=/trunk/; revision=19643
2003-01-27 06:20:35 +00:00
734a5f154e only do the CONDUIT_CFLAGS/LIBS stuff if pilot conduits have been enabled.
2003-01-26  Chris Toshok  <toshok@ximian.com>

	* configure.in: only do the CONDUIT_CFLAGS/LIBS stuff if pilot
	conduits have been enabled.

svn path=/trunk/; revision=19638
2003-01-27 02:53:32 +00:00
2a000947a5 in the --enable-pilot-conduits stanza, use PKG_CHECK_MODULES to get the
2003-01-26  Chris Toshok  <toshok@ximian.com>

	* configure.in: in the --enable-pilot-conduits stanza, use
	PKG_CHECK_MODULES to get the gnome-pilot-2.0 (and therefore
	pilot-link) cflags/libs before doing our utf-8 check.  also,
	enable the addressbook/calendar CONDUIT_{CFLAGS/LIBS} variables.

svn path=/trunk/; revision=19637
2003-01-26 23:56:53 +00:00
5c64c7c93c (evolutionuidir): Define iconsdir.
svn path=/trunk/; revision=19618
2003-01-24 18:10:32 +00:00
be96dc88ff Doh. Use the MANUAL_[NSPR,NSS]_[CFLAGS,LIBS] variables where appropriate.
2003-01-24  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in (FULL_GNOME_DEPS): Doh. Use the
	MANUAL_[NSPR,NSS]_[CFLAGS,LIBS] variables where appropriate.

svn path=/trunk/; revision=19613
2003-01-24 06:16:29 +00:00
b4e888b7b5 more fixes
svn path=/trunk/; revision=19596
2003-01-23 20:56:42 +00:00
63066de30a manually check for mozilla nspr/nss if the user specifies --enable-nss=static or passes in any --with-foo flags for nspr/nss includes/libs or if pkg-config fails for any reason.
svn path=/trunk/; revision=19595
2003-01-23 19:57:54 +00:00
a47f03c9bc (idldir): Define componentdir instead of
COMPONENT_DIR.  Set it to $privlibdir/components instead of
$libdir/evolution-$(BASE_VERSION)/components.

svn path=/trunk/; revision=19593
2003-01-23 19:34:27 +00:00
66a137db53 Simplify the whole process into about 8 lines by using pkg-config.
2003-01-22  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in (MOZILLA_NSS): Simplify the whole process into
	about 8 lines by using pkg-config.

svn path=/trunk/; revision=19576
2003-01-22 22:53:20 +00:00
05114bc495 For now, do not install the evolution.1 manpage. Install all the other
* data/Makefile.am: For now, do not install the evolution.1
manpage.  Install all the other files with a -$(BASE_VERSION)
suffix.
(dtappintegrate): Update for the new location of cde_app_root.
(dtappunintegrate): Likewise.

* data/cde_app_root/dt/appconfig/appmanager/C/Ximian/Makefile.am
(cdeappmanagerdir): Version using $(BASE_VERSION).
* data/cde_app_root/dt/appconfig/types/C/Makefile.am
(cdetypesdir): Likewise.
* data/cde_app_root/dt/appconfig/icons/C/Makefile.am
(cdeiconsdir): Likewise.

* sounds/Makefile.am (soundsdir): Version using $(BASE_VERSION).

* configure.in: Define BASE_VERSION.  Set idldir to
$datadir/idl/evolution-$BASE_VERSION instead of just
$datadir/idl/evolution.

svn path=/trunk/; revision=19550
2003-01-22 20:02:32 +00:00
16b54010c9 applied patch from Frederic Crozat <fcrozat@mandrakesoft.com>
svn path=/trunk/; revision=19540
2003-01-21 17:23:38 +00:00
eca2fa78fe (ALL_LINGUAS): Remove fr for now, since it doesn't
seem to work.
(AC_OUTPUT): Remove calendar/importers/Makefile for now.

svn path=/trunk/; revision=19450
2003-01-14 17:42:07 +00:00
d04f81295a (ALL_LINGUAS): Remove fr for now, since it doesn't
seem to work.

svn path=/trunk/; revision=19445
2003-01-14 17:33:46 +00:00
5c410ab142 add po
* Makefile.am (SUBDIRS): add po

	* configure.in: Move ALL_LINGUAS definition to before
	AM_GLIB_GNU_GETTEXT, or else no linguas for you!

svn path=/trunk/; revision=19267
2003-01-07 21:04:50 +00:00
0409612786 Added "am.po" to the ALL_LINGUAS list.
svn path=/trunk/; revision=19255
2003-01-07 15:58:43 +00:00
cd6da3a0c9 Use "Evolution", not "evolution", since that becomes the value of the
* configure.in (AC_INIT): Use "Evolution", not "evolution", since
	that becomes the value of the PACKAGE variable
	(privlibdir): parse $VERSION by hand since.
	EVOLUTION_MAJOR_VERSION, etc aren't defined any more (and trying
	to pass a variable to AC_INIT won't work). This and the above
	change fix the problem that privlibdir was being defined as
	"${libdir}/Evolution/." instead of "${libdir}/evolution/1.3"
	(GAL_VERSION): AC_SUBST this since it's needed in the .pc files
	(idldir): define this here rather than in each Makefile.am that
	needs it.
	(AC_OUTPUT): Add .pc files

	* Makefile.am (pkgconfig_DATA): Add pc files.
	(confexec_DATA): Remove this (fooConf.sh files)
	(SUBDIRS): Move filter earlier in the build. (I think it was
	calendar that depends on it now?)
	(%Conf.sh): Remove this. The .pc files are output by configure.in
	now.

	* camel.pc.in, evolution-addressbook.pc.in,
	evolution-calendar.pc.in, evolution-shell.pc.in: Replace the
	*Conf.sh files with these. In addition to the basic variables,
	include camel_providerdir (in camel.pc) and idldir, IDL_INCLUDES
	and privlibdir (in the others).

svn path=/trunk/; revision=19241
2003-01-06 14:16:59 +00:00
aef8f713ae Define COMPONENT_DIR.
* configure.in: Define COMPONENT_DIR.

* Makefile.am (componentdir): Install in $(COMPONENT_DIR), not in
${prefix}/evolution/components.

svn path=/trunk/; revision=19008
2002-12-04 20:38:42 +00:00
27f4b6bd27 Add NSPR CFLAGS and LDFLAGS to the E_UTIL build flags.
2002-11-22  Jeffrey Stedfast  <fejj@ximian.com>

	* configure.in: Add NSPR CFLAGS and LDFLAGS to the E_UTIL build
	flags.

svn path=/trunk/; revision=18892
2002-11-22 22:26:20 +00:00
abb2d6725e AC_OUTPUT(my-evoluton/Makefile).
svn path=/trunk/; revision=18866
2002-11-20 22:09:31 +00:00
9f5ba47f84 Check for gconftool-2, and added
AM_GCONF_SOURCE_2.

svn path=/trunk/; revision=18846
2002-11-19 21:29:34 +00:00
be05081ea9 Added back IMPORTERS_CFLAGS and mail/importers/Makefile
2002-11-18  Not Zed  <NotZed@Ximian.com>

	* configure.in: Added back IMPORTERS_CFLAGS and
	mail/importers/Makefile

svn path=/trunk/; revision=18820
2002-11-18 11:27:35 +00:00